This feels like a speed typing game. Half the time, I knew the right word but made a typo because I was rushed while typing. Maybe offer multiple choice answers to click on that correlate to the words appearing? That would also improve word recognition for vocabulary that is familiar but not mastered.
I was really disappointed because this app does seems like it has some potential as it does seem like an addictive game to play, but I can’t even play if I dont know what the words mean in the first place.
